BASF Kids’ Lab, Singapore 2016
How does a free children’s Chemistry workshop by one of the world’s leading Chemical companies sound? Back for its 13th year, BASF Kids’ Lab, run by one of the world’s leading chemical company is organizing its highly popular workshop here in Singapore again in November 2016 at the Ang Mo Kio Public Library. These workshops are customised for children ages 6 to 12 and guided by qualified staff to raise awareness and ignite children's interest in Science! Details of BASF Kids' Lab … [Read more...]

Wicked – The Musical in Singapore 2016
“Wicked’ returns to Singapore direct from a multi record-breaking tour of the UK. Since the musical began 13 years ago, it has won 100 international awards, including three Tony Awards on Broadway and two Olivier Awards in London's West End. What is the story about? Should I bring my family to watch it? Is it for suitable for kids? Read on!
